#4cd852 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cd852 is composed of 29.8% red, 84.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 62%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 122.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 57.3%. #4cd852 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ffa4 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#4cd852 color description : Moderate lime green.

#4cd852 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4cd852 has RGB values of R:76, G:216,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5036114.

Shades and Tints of #4cd852

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e04 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cd852

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f958f is the less saturated color, while #2afa33 is the most saturated one.
